Exploring Make.com for Real Estate Automation
Make.com, previously known as Integromat, is an advanced visual platform that allows real estate agents to connect hundreds of apps and automate workflows effortlessly. This platform stands out due to its ability to execute complex automations with its user-friendly drag-and-drop interface. At the time of writing, users report that Make.com offers smooth integration capabilities, thereby reducing the time spent on administrative tasks.
By employing Make.com, real estate professionals can use the platform to automate email campaigns for new listings, set up alerts for property inquiries, and synchronize information across their CRM systems and marketing tools. The flexibility and customizability of Make.com make it a top choice for agents seeking tailored solutions. Furthermore, the platform supports scenarios that can range from simple to highly advanced, accommodating the needs of both beginners and tech-savvy users alike.
Pricing for Make.com starts with a free tier, offering limited operations for users who want to experiment. The plans scale up in pricing and features, with professional plans starting at $9/month, perfect for small to medium-sized agencies looking for expanded capabilities.
Users appreciate the platform’s solid documentation and forum support, which can be incredibly helpful for those looking to get the most out of the tool’s capabilities. Make.com’s ability to handle complex automations without requiring extensive coding knowledge is frequently highlighted in user reviews.

Maximizing Efficiency with Zapier
Zapier is a widely recognized name in the automation space, offering substantial functionality for real estate agents looking to simplify tasks. Zapier enables users to connect over 3,000 apps, providing endless possibilities to automate various operations. This tool is known for its effortless integration processes and extensive compatibility with popular platforms used by real estate professionals.
Agents use Zapier to automate listing updates across multiple platforms, manage client follow-ups with autoresponder emails, and synchronize contact information smoothly between databases. Its “Zap” setup is intuitive, guiding users through creating workflows that require no coding expertise. This makes Zapier an accessible choice for real estate professionals who prefer simplicity without sacrificing functionality.
The platform offers flexible pricing with a free tier for basic automations and a professional plan starting at $19.99/month, unlocking premium features and higher task limits essential for growing businesses.
Benchmark results confirm Zapier’s reliability and strong performance even during high data throughput scenarios. User reviews frequently praise its responsive customer support team, setting it apart in a crowded market.

Optimizing Operations with n8n
n8n is a powerful automation tool that shines with its self-hosting capabilities and open-source flexibility. This platform appeals particularly to tech-savvy real estate agents who prefer customizing solutions to meet specific needs. n8n provides a wide array of integrations, allowing the automation of tasks ranging from lead management to property listing updates.
Unlike many competing tools, n8n delivers extensive customization without incurring any subscription costs, though businesses can opt for cloud-hosted solutions billed according to resource consumption. This cost-efficient approach makes n8n an attractive option for agents looking to minimize expenses without compromising on capabilities.
User reviews suggest n8n’s native integration with popular CRM systems and marketing platforms is a definitive edge, allowing for the smooth transition of data across systems. Moreover, the platform’s intuitive user interface is intuitive while being deeply informative, making it easier for users to navigate complexities.
At the time of writing, n8n is gaining traction as a go-to automation solution for those preferring full control over their data processes, offering benefits like data localization and privacy.

Unlocking Potential with Workato
Workato is a leader in enterprise-grade automation tools, offering advanced capabilities suited for larger real estate firms and brokerages. The platform supports smooth integrations, enabling comprehensive workflows that can handle the complexities of enterprise operations. Workato stands out through its strong features, providing capabilities such as automatic data migration, sales funnel analytics, and property database management.
For real estate teams managing diverse software ecosystems, Workato simplifies the creation of cross-functional workflows, leading to improved efficiency and data consistency throughout the organization. It offers various pricing plans, starting at $249/month, which cater to enterprises looking to improve their automation strategies significantly.
Users have praised Workato for its comprehensive support system and high success rates in deploying large-scale automations. This tool’s visual editor makes creating complicated workflows manageable even for users without extensive technical skills.

Transforming Workflows with Tray.io
Tray.io offers an new approach to automation, providing flexible and powerful solutions for real estate agents looking to improve workflows. The platform is designed for complex integrations and is well-suited for mid-sized to large firms wishing to create sophisticated automations. Tray.io’s visual workflow builder and API integration capabilities are noteworthy highlights that enable users to deploy solutions efficiently across their tech stacks.
Real estate professionals can take advantage of Tray.io to automate client onboarding processes, synchronize property listings across platforms, and manage customer interactions. Its extensive library of connectors also simplifies connecting various applications that agents commonly use, such as CRM systems, email marketing tools, and property management software.
Tray.io’s pricing begins at $595/month, reflecting its orientation towards businesses that demand advanced integration capabilities. Users report high satisfaction levels with Tray.io’s ability to handle complex workflows effortlessly, often citing its intuitive UI as a standout feature.

Enhancing Processes with Microsoft Power Automate
Microsoft Power Automate, formerly known as Microsoft Flow, is a versatile cloud-based platform designed to simplify business operations for real estate agents. With its integration into the Microsoft ecosystem, the platform offers powerful automation features for teams already using Microsoft’s suite of products.
Power Automate enables agents to automate tasks such as document management, client follow-ups, and data sharing. It effortlessly connects with Office 365 applications, providing a unified environment for agents to manage their workflows. At the time of writing, the extensive support documentations and community make it an approachable option for newcomers and experienced users alike.
The platform offers various pricing tiers, starting with a free plan and scaling up to premium features with the per-user plan at $15 per month. This flexibility in pricing makes Power Automate a favorable solution for agencies of all sizes.
Users frequently compliment Power Automate’s smooth integration with other Microsoft products and its capabilities to automate repetitive tasks efficiently. Reviewers suggest it’s an excellent choice for real estate professionals comfortable with the Microsoft suite.

Mistakes That Cost You Money
Automation can offer significant savings and efficiency, but real estate agents need to be aware of potential mistakes that could result in financial losses. Here, we explore three critical pitfalls to avoid:
Firstly, over-automation can lead to complications where simple tasks become unduly complex due to unnecessary automation. Agents should critically evaluate what tasks genuinely benefit from automation to prevent inefficiencies.
Secondly, failing to regularly review and update automation workflows can result in processes running on outdated data or methods. Regular audits ensure that the automation remains relevant and effective, adapting to new tools or needs.
Finally, neglecting cybersecurity protocols can expose sensitive client information to potential breaches. Real estate professionals should ensure all automation tools comply with industry regulations and apply best practices for data protection. Investing time in understanding and implementing cybersecurity measures today can prevent costly setbacks in the future.

Frequently Asked Questions
Here are some common questions about automation tools in real estate, complete with concise answers to ease readers’ understanding:
1. **What is the benefit of using automation tools in real estate?** Automation tools help real estate agents save time on repetitive tasks, improve efficiency, and increase focus on more complex responsibilities such as client engagement and negotiations.
2. **Can I use more than one automation tool?** Yes, combining different tools can enhance productivity advantages, but care should be taken to ensure integrations do not conflict or cause complications.
3. **Are all automation tools suitable for small or solo real estate agents?** While many tools offer plans that cater to smaller operations, agents should review their specific needs and budgets, as some tools are better suited for larger organizations.
4. **How do I select the best automation tool for my agency?** Consider factors like budget, feature requirements, ease of integration with existing systems, and level of user expertise required when selecting a tool.
5. **What is the role of a CRM in automation?** CRMs often serve as a central hub for customer data, and automating processes involving CRMs can significantly enhance data accuracy and client relationship management.
6. **How secure is data with automation platforms?** Trusted automation tools enforce strong security measures, but agents should still perform their complete due diligence on security credentials and compliance standards before adoption.
7. **Can these tools help with lead generation?** Yes, many automation tools can help identify, capture, and manage leads efficiently, improving lead conversion rates.
8. **Are there hidden costs associated with automation tools?** While some tools offer free plans, there can be additional costs like premium subscriptions, integration limits, or data threshold overages that users need to check before committing.
